Transaction 88df856662bb2cf878e87e75d0d4a74ab733bb6079080163e2c04eae03507938

1 Input
2 Outputs
  • 88df856662bb2cf878e87e75d0d4a74ab733bb6079080163e2c04eae03507938:0
  • value  3809213708
    address  1Ca4knPak3QoAnndRNwZahYAuPeyozbPMf
  • 88df856662bb2cf878e87e75d0d4a74ab733bb6079080163e2c04eae03507938:1
  • value  42629380
    address  1E8EvaKAQhNTfytpnTFbh4XMAB9TSP3Z4f